Output d8e5c2503128c4ac3bda6577458c976e34097d5cfe21b305b6ce3050d473183e:1

value
629806534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ceb89c2daa14982c1f8878c60df0c2632620831 OP_EQUALVERIFY OP_CHECKSIG
address
16Z7hzBoBYFFQ58KwkwxVEaYm4ZRSwT6vs
transaction
d8e5c2503128c4ac3bda6577458c976e34097d5cfe21b305b6ce3050d473183e
spent
true